Why Rockfish Is a Culinary Favorite

Rockfish encompasses over 60 species, including Granada rockfish, kelp rockfish, and striped rockfish, all known for their dense flesh and distinct flavor. It’s low in fat, high in protein, and rich in omega-3 fatty acids, making it both delicious and nutritious. Whether seared with garlic and citrus or gently baked in a white wine sauce, rockfish adapts well to global cuisines while retaining its unique character.


1. Baked Rockfish with Herb Butter

One of the simplest yet most satisfying ways to enjoy rockfish is by baking it whole with a fragrant herb butter. Place a fresh or frozen rockfish fillet—skin on for best texture—on a parchment-lined baking sheet. Mix softened butter with minced garlic, chopped parsley, thyme, lemon zest, and a pinch of salt and pepper. Spread over the fish before baking at 375°F (190°C) for 15–20 minutes until golden and flake-friendly. Serve with steamed asparagus and buttery mashed potatoes.

3. Pan-Seared Rockfish with Lemon Garlic Sauce

Pan-searing rockfish yields a crispy crust and a juicy interior. Season fillets with salt and pepper, then cook in high heat with olive oil and butter until golden. Remove and prepare a quick sauce by sautéing minced garlic and fresh lemon juice, reducing to a glossy finish, and tossing with sliced almonds or capers. Drizzle over the fish for a restaurant-quality bite.

Tips for Cooking Rockfish Perfectly

  • Always buy rockfish from reputable sources to ensure freshness and sustainability.
  • Season lightly before cooking—rockfish can become mushy if over-salted.
  • Cook gently and avoid overcooking; internal temperature should reach 145°F (63°C).
  • Pair with bright citrus, herbs like dill or parsley, and light grains to balance richness.
